Bill Gates says accusations in Epstein files are ‘completely ridiculous’


Reports about Bill Gates’ connections with Jeffrey Epstein have become more alarming with each one Unpacking documents From the Ministry of Justice. The latest includes somewhat confusing emails that Epstein may have been drafting on behalf of someone named Boriswho worked for the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ation. The letters claim that Bill had contracted a sexually transmitted disease and wanted to “surreptitiously” administer antibiotics to Melinda. It also claims that Bell had “encounters” with married women and “Russian girls.”

“These allegations are completely ridiculous and completely false. The only thing these documents show is Epstein’s frustration that he did not have an ongoing relationship with Gates and the lengths he would go to trap and defame.”

It is not clear who Boris is referred to in the emails, or whether the messages were sent to anyone. Epstein is listed only in the From and To fields.

Gates’ relationship with Epstein has become a major issue for the billionaire philanthropist. He initially downplayed the significance of his relationships, but documents indicated they were Closer than Gates admitted. He has repeatedly denied being associated with Epstein outside the country Fundraising and charitable efforts and said that their meetings were “Big mistakeHowever, Melinda Gates reported that Bill was linked to Epstein played a role In her decision File for divorce.
